    Non biodegradable bags

    Non biodegradable bags

    Plastic bags that are given out at grocery stores are non-biodegradable. Which means they can not be broken down in a safe way by the Earth. The substance that is non-biodegradable can not be changed to a harmless natural state by the action of bacteria. It is a danger to our ecosystem. So instead you could get re-useable bags that are only $.59 at Marc’s and there are many choices to pick from.

    The non-biodegradable plastic bags are polyethylene. The production of the bags contributes to air pollution and energy consumption. As of July 1, 2018 Cuyahoga County will consider legislation enacting a fee charging 10 cents for each plastic bag used at grocery and department store. This action will reduce pollution and help clean up of the lakes.
